Web Developers Salary Distribution in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area

The earning potential for Web Developerss in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area varies significantly by experience level. There is a substantial income gap, with top earners (90th percentile) making over 3.0x the starting salary. This indicates strong career progression opportunities. Entry-level roles (10th percentile) typically start around $34,540, while highly experienced professionals can command wages upwards of $102,280.

How much does a Web Developers make in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area?

The median annual salary for a Web Developers in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area is $68,730. This typically ranges from $34,540 for entry-level positions to $102,280 for top-level roles.

How does the salary compare to the national average?

The average salary for this role in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area is 31.1% lower than the national median of $99,700.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 30 employees in the Hill Country Region of Texas nonmetropolitan area area with a job density of 0.161 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
